Activity itinerary

Key Largo (Pass by)
Travellers pass through the Dive Capital of the World, known for its coral reefs, mangroves, and the famous African Queen boat.
John Pennekamp Coral Reef State Park (Pass by)
Located in Key Largo, this is the first undersea park in the US, known for clear waters and vibrant marine life.
Tavernier (Pass by)
A small community between Key Largo and Islamorada with classic Florida Keys charm.
Islamorada
  • 30m
Known for: Sportfishing capital of the world Robbie’s Marina, home of the famous tarpon feeding Rain Barrel Village (giant lobster “Betsy”) 30 minutes breakfast stop at Rain Barrel Village with great photo opportunities
Lower Matecumbe Key (Pass by)
Scenic bridges and beautiful coastal views.
Seven Mile Bridge (Pass by)
One of the most famous bridges in the world. Travellers see both: The modern Seven Mile Bridge The historic Old Seven Mile Bridge
Bahia Honda State Park (Pass by)
Known for its award-winning beaches and legendary views of the old Flagler Railway bridge.
Key West
  • 6m
Enjoy six full hours to explore Key West at your own pace. Visit iconic landmarks such as the Southernmost Point Buoy, Mallory Square, Duval Street, the Ernest Hemingway Home & Museum, Key West Lighthouse, and Fort Zachary Taylor Historic State Park. Discover presidential history at the Harry S. Truman Little White House, treasure stories at the Mel Fisher Maritime Museum, tropical beauty at the Key West Butterfly & Nature Conservatory, and the charm of the Historic Seaport. Don’t forget to stop by US 1 Mile Marker Zero, the official beginning (or end) of the legendary Overseas Highway.
